Patient Autonomy and Informed Consent
One of the key ethical considerations for phlebotomists using gene editing technologies is ensuring patient autonomy and Informed Consent. Patients must have the right to make decisions about their own genetic information and whether they want to undergo Genetic Testing or treatment. Phlebotomists must obtain Informed Consent from patients before collecting samples for Genetic Testing and clearly explain the risks and benefits of gene editing technologies.

Patient Confidentiality and Privacy
Phlebotomists must also prioritize Patient Confidentiality and privacy when handling genetic information. Genetic data is highly sensitive and can reveal information about an individual's health, ancestry, and predisposition to diseases. Phlebotomists must ensure that genetic information is kept secure and only shared with authorized individuals on a need-to-know basis.

Equity, Justice, and Access
Phlebotomists must also consider ethical issues around equity, justice, and access when utilizing gene editing technologies. These cutting-edge tools have the potential to revolutionize healthcare, but there are concerns about unequal access to gene editing treatments based on factors such as income, race, or geographic location. Phlebotomists must advocate for fair and equitable distribution of gene editing technologies to ensure that all patients have access to these life-saving treatments.
